Random number generators

Random number generators (RNG) are the brains of digital technology behind slot machines. They generate random numbers rapidly and determine the positions of the reels. This increases the excitement of slot games because they make each spin unpredictable. RNGs are sophisticated algorithms that generate random outcomes. They eliminate patterns and increase the probability of unpredictability. The generated numbers are used to select symbols that are displayed on the reels.

When slot machines transitioned from mechanical to digital, designers needed a way to guarantee that the outcome of each spin was random. They turned to random number generators, which are similar to the microprocessors you find in your computer and smartphone. These computer programs look at a variety of factors, such as player interaction and time-based seeds to produce a set of numbers that can't be predicted or duplicated.

There are two kinds of pseudorandom numbers generators, and real random generated numbers. Both generate a set random numbers but only the latter can be capable of producing true random results. Although pseudorandom numbers aren't as reliable as a true random number generator however, it is more suitable for casinos. It is possible to operate multiple machines using the same code, and keep a steady output.





There are a few misconceptions regarding the randomness of slot machine outcomes. Some players believe that slot machines go through hot and cold cycles, but this isn't the case. Whatever number of spins you play the RNG constantly selects new random numbers and determining the outcome of each one.

RNGs protect casinos against fraud and manipulation, as well as making sure that all spins will be random. This is the reason they are regulated by government agencies as well as independent testing bodies, allowing gamblers to be confident that their games are fair and impartial. Slot machines are fun, whether you play them in Las Vegas, or at home. These games are designed to keep players interested and entertained by various sounds that reward their winners and punish players for their losses. Some of the sounds are clattering nickels, quarters and dollars dropping into a metal bin inside the machine, while others are the sound of chirping or orchestrated music that heighten players' anticipation and excitement.

These sounds might not be enough to keep players returning, but they can influence their choices and overall gaming experience. In fact, a study by Marmurek, Finlay, Kanetkar and Londerville discovered that the sound that accompanied a multiline video slots game influenced players' arousal, both physically and psychologically. The sounds caused players to overestimate the amount of money they could win during a session.
